  7. Feb 23, 2023 · An onshore company is a company that is incorporated in the same country that you are a resident. For example, if you live and reside in the UK, your onshore business will be a UK company and will be subject to UK regulations. An offshore company is a legal entity incorporated in a jurisdiction outside of the owners home country.
